Single Flange Butterfly Valve An Overview


The single flange butterfly valve is a significant component widely used in various industrial applications, owing to its simplicity, cost-effectiveness, and efficiency. These valves are specifically designed to regulate and control the flow of fluids in a pipeline, making them indispensable in sectors such as water treatment, chemical processing, power generation, and HVAC systems.


Design and Structure


The single flange butterfly valve consists of a circular disk or vane that rotates around a central axis, allowing for smooth opening and closing of the valve. The valve is named for its design, which resembles a butterfly that opens and closes with respect to the rotational movement of the disk. The single flange design refers to the valve being connected to the piping system with just one flange on either side, facilitating easier installation and maintenance compared to double-flanged valves.


The basic structure of a single flange butterfly valve includes three primary components the body, the disc, and the actuator. The body is typically made from materials like stainless steel, ductile iron, or PVC, depending on the application and the type of fluid being conveyed. The disc, which is pivotal to the valve’s operation, is usually coated with a corrosion-resistant material to extend its lifespan. Lastly, the actuator, which can be manual or powered (electrical or pneumatic), is responsible for the operation of the valve.


Advantages


One of the most significant advantages of the single flange butterfly valve is its compact design. Unlike other valve types, such as gate or globe valves, the butterfly valve takes up considerably less space in the pipeline, making it an ideal choice for installations with limited space. Another key benefit is its lightweight nature, which reduces the structural support requirements in piping systems.

Cost-effectiveness is another critical aspect. Single flange butterfly valves are generally less expensive than their multi-flange counterparts and other valve types. This makes them a popular choice for budget-conscious projects. Furthermore, the relatively simple design translates to easier manufacturing processes, which further drives down costs.


In terms of performance, single flange butterfly valves provide excellent flow control with minimal pressure drop. The streamlined flow path of the disc allows for efficient fluid movement, which is crucial in applications where maintenance of pressure and flow rate is essential. They can handle various fluids, including gases, liquids, and slurries, and can operate under a wide range of temperatures and pressures.


Applications


The versatility of single flange butterfly valves enables their use in diverse industries. In water treatment facilities, they are often employed to control the flow of water through filtration and treatment processes. In chemical plants, these valves are used to manage the flow of corrosive substances safely. In power plants, they assist in regulating steam and cooling water flows. Additionally, HVAC systems benefit from these valves for modulating airflow.
